Arkansans to lose over-the-air access to 'Daniel Tiger,' 'NOVA,' and other PBS shows
The channel known as Arkansas PBS will no longer be able to broadcast PBS programs starting July 1, 2026, thanks to federal budget cuts signed into law earlier this year.
